Get AS112 DNS queries time series

radar.as112.timeseries(AS112TimeseriesParams**kwargs) -> AS112TimeseriesResponse
GET/radar/as112/timeseries

Retrieves the AS112 DNS queries over time.

Security
API Token

The preferred authorization scheme for interacting with the Cloudflare API. Create a token.

Example:Authorization: Bearer Sn3lZJTBX6kkg7OdcBUAxOO963GEIyGQqnFTOFYY
API Email + API Key

The previous authorization scheme for interacting with the Cloudflare API, used in conjunction with a Global API key.

Example:X-Auth-Email: user@example.com

The previous authorization scheme for interacting with the Cloudflare API. When possible, use API tokens instead of Global API keys.

Example:X-Auth-Key: 144c9defac04969c7bfad8efaa8ea194

ParametersExpand Collapse
agg_interval: Optional[Literal["15m", "1h", "1d", "1w"]]

Aggregation interval of the results (e.g., in 15 minutes or 1 hour intervals). Refer to Aggregation intervals.

One of the following:
"15m"
"1h"
"1d"
"1w"
continent: Optional[SequenceNotStr[str]]

Filters results by continent. Specify a comma-separated list of alpha-2 codes. Prefix with - to exclude continents from results. For example, -EU,NA excludes results from EU, but includes results from NA.

date_end: Optional[SequenceNotStr[Union[str, datetime]]]

End of the date range (inclusive).

date_range: Optional[SequenceNotStr[str]]

Filters results by date range. For example, use 7d and 7dcontrol to compare this week with the previous week. Use this parameter or set specific start and end dates (dateStart and dateEnd parameters).

date_start: Optional[SequenceNotStr[Union[str, datetime]]]

Start of the date range.

format: Optional[Literal["JSON", "CSV"]]

Format in which results will be returned.

One of the following:
"JSON"
"CSV"
location: Optional[SequenceNotStr[str]]

Filters results by location. Specify a comma-separated list of alpha-2 codes. Prefix with - to exclude locations from results. For example, -US,PT excludes results from the US, but includes results from PT.

name: Optional[SequenceNotStr[str]]

Array of names used to label the series in the response.

protocol: Optional[List[Literal["UDP", "TCP", "HTTPS", "TLS"]]]

Filters results by DNS transport protocol.

One of the following:
"UDP"
"TCP"
"HTTPS"
"TLS"

Get AS112 DNS queries time series

import os
from cloudflare import Cloudflare

client = Cloudflare(
    api_token=os.environ.get("CLOUDFLARE_API_TOKEN"),  # This is the default and can be omitted
)
response = client.radar.as112.timeseries()
print(response.meta)
{
  "result": {
    "meta": {
      "aggInterval": "FIFTEEN_MINUTES",
      "confidenceInfo": {
        "annotations": [
          {
            "dataSource": "ALL",
            "description": "Cable cut in Tonga",
            "endDate": "2019-12-27T18:11:19.117Z",
            "eventType": "EVENT",
            "isInstantaneous": true,
            "linkedUrl": "https://example.com",
            "startDate": "2019-12-27T18:11:19.117Z"
          }
        ],
        "level": 0
      },
      "dateRange": [
        {
          "endTime": "2022-09-17T10:22:57.555Z",
          "startTime": "2022-09-16T10:22:57.555Z"
        }
      ],
      "lastUpdated": "2019-12-27T18:11:19.117Z",
      "normalization": "PERCENTAGE",
      "units": [
        {
          "name": "*",
          "value": "requests"
        }
      ]
    }
  },
  "success": true
}
